Beiträge von Rolf_Mueller

    Guten Morgen


    immer wenn ich durch dini etwas neues speichern möchte:


    stock Register(playerid,key[])
    {
    new Playerdatei[128];
    new name[MAX_PLAYER_NAME];
    GetPlayerName(playerid,name,sizeof(name));
    format(Playerdatei,sizeof(Playerdatei),"/Accounts/%s.ini",name);
    dini_Create(Playerdatei);
    dini_Set(Playerdatei,"Passwort",key);
    SendClientMessage(playerid,Grün,"Du hast dich erfolgreich eingeloggt.");
    SetPlayerScore(playerid,0);
    dini_IntSet(Playerdatei,"Adminlevel",0);
    SetPVarInt(playerid,"Eingeloggt",1);
    SetPVarInt(playerid,"Freigeschaltet",0); //neu hinzugefügt.
    return 1;
    }


    stock AccountLaden(playerid)
    {
    new Playerdatei[128];
    new name[MAX_PLAYER_NAME];
    GetPlayerName(playerid,name,sizeof(name));
    format(Playerdatei,sizeof(Playerdatei),"/Accounts/%s.ini",name);
    SetPlayerScore(playerid,dini_Int(Playerdatei,"Level"));
    GivePlayerMoney(playerid,dini_Int(Playerdatei,"Geld"));
    SetPVarInt(playerid,"Adminlevel",dini_Int(Playerdatei,"Adminlevel"));
    SetPVarInt(playerid,"Eingeloggt",1);
    if(GetPVarInt(playerid,"Baned")==1)
    {
    SendClientMessage(playerid,Rot,"Du bist vom Server gebannt!");
    Kick(playerid);
    }
    if(GetPVarInt(playerid,"Freigeschaltet")==0) // eingefügt
    {
    SendClientMessage(playerid,Rot,"Du wurdest noch nicht freigeschaltet,melde dich bitte bei einem Admin!!"); //eingefügt
    Kick(playerid);//eingefügt
    }
    return 1;


    wird in den Accountdaten nur das Passwort und das Adminlevel angezeigt.
    kann man nur eine bestimmte anzahl von daten speichern??? Oder woran liegt das Problem.

    Hallo


    ich habe folgendes Problem wenn ich mich einloge werde ich zwar an die in den Accountdaten gespeicherten Ort gebracht,wenn ich dann aber auf Spawn klicke werde ich wieder in Lv an dieser Rolltreppe gespawnt.Wie kann ich es machen das man nur nach dem registrieren dort gespawnt werde?

    Guten Abend


    Ich weiß das diese Frage schon 1000x gestellt wurde.
    Ich checke aber einfach nicht wie ich es scripten kann das nach dem einlogen die Skinauswahl nicht angezeigt wird.
    Also ich erkläre das mal an dem folgenden Besipiel:


    User registriert sich: skinasuwahl wird angezeigt.
    User loggt sich ein Skinauswahl wird nicht abgezeigt,erst wenn man im Binco seinen Skin ändern möchte.


    Ich hoffe das ihr mir helfen könnt.

    Ich bin an einem Kick/Bann Befehl und bekomme nun leider folgende Errors:


    Zitat

    Zeile (359) : Unbekannte Variable : "sscanf"
    Zeile (371) : Unbekannte Variable : "sscanf"


    if(sscanf(params,"us",pID,Grund))return SendClientMessage(playerid,Gelb,"Benutzung: /kick [ID] [Grund]"); Zeile 595
    if(sscanf(params,"us",pID,reason))return SendClientMessage(playerid,Gelb,"Benutzung: /ban [ID] [Grund]");


    [hide]Vielen Dank für eure Hilfe.[/hide]

    Ich bekomme bei compillen folgenden Error:


    Zitat

    Zeile (338) : error 055: start of function body without function header


    Hier die Zeile:
    stock IstSpielerEinAdmin(playerid,rang);
    Ich sehe in der Zeile keinen Fehler den es ist ja ein stock vorhanden!!!



    Hoffe das ihr mir helfen könnt.

    Ich habe ein Problem und zwar werde ich wenn ich mich einlogen bzw registrieren möchte.Vom Server geworfen,nicht gekickt sondern es ist so als würde ich /q eingeben.


    Hier die Serverlogs:


    Zitat

    [19:21:49] [join] Arti92 has joined the server (0:62.143.5.155)
    [19:21:54] [part] Arti92 has left the server (0:2)


    Ich habe die Vermutung das es etwas mit dem MySQL zu tuen hat,deshalb habe ich hier die logs vom MySQL.



    Kennt ihr das Problem? Oder hattet ihr das Problem auch mal?
    Oder wisst ihr was man dagegen tuen kann?
    Oder kann es vielleicht an einem Fehler im Script liegen?

    Ich habe das Plugin mysql.so auf meinen Linuxserver(gta-servers) hochgeladen,und in den server.cfg unter plugins reingeschrieben.Nur wenn ich jetzt den Server starte steht in den serverlogs folgende Errornachricht:

    Zitat

    Server Plugins [17:11:30] -------------- [17:11:30] Loading plugin: mysql.so [17:11:30] Failed (libmysqlclient_r.so.16: cannot open shared object file: No such file or directory) [17:11:30] Loaded 0 plugins.


    Wie kann ich diesen Error nun beheben?